Head to head by decade
| Decade | Poland | Uruguay |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 100.0% | 95.7% | 4.3% | Poland |
| 2010s | 100.0% | 99.5% | 0.5% | Poland |
| 2020s | 100.0% | 99.9% | 0.1% | Poland |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
